🎬 Why K-Dramas Have Become a Global Phenomenon

Korean dramas have evolved from a regional entertainment format to a worldwide cultural movement. Their unique storytelling approach combines romance, comedy, thriller elements, and deep emotional narratives that resonate across cultural boundaries. Unlike Western television series that often span multiple seasons, K-dramas typically tell complete stories within 16-20 episodes, making them perfect for binge-watching.

Anúncios

The production quality of K-dramas has reached cinematic levels, with stunning cinematography, carefully crafted soundtracks, and fashion-forward styling that influences trends globally. From historical epics to contemporary romantic comedies, the variety ensures there’s something for every viewer’s taste.

Social media has amplified the K-drama phenomenon, creating passionate international communities that discuss plot twists, favorite characters, and memorable scenes. This global fanbase has motivated streaming platforms to invest heavily in Korean content, making it more accessible than ever before.

📱 Essential Features to Look for in a K-Drama Streaming App

When choosing an app to watch K-dramas, certain features can significantly enhance your viewing experience. Understanding what to prioritize helps you select the platform that best meets your needs and preferences.

Subtitle Quality and Language Options

High-quality subtitles are non-negotiable for international K-drama viewers. The best apps offer professionally translated subtitles in multiple languages, allowing you to enjoy content in your preferred language. Some platforms even provide community-contributed translations that often capture cultural nuances better than automated systems.

Look for apps that allow you to adjust subtitle size, color, and positioning. These customization options make reading subtitles more comfortable, especially during extended viewing sessions. Some advanced platforms even offer dual subtitle options, displaying both your native language and Korean simultaneously for language learners.

Video Quality and Streaming Performance

Nothing ruins the viewing experience faster than buffering or poor video quality. Premium streaming apps should offer multiple resolution options, from standard definition for slower connections to 4K for those with high-speed internet and compatible devices.

Adaptive streaming technology automatically adjusts video quality based on your internet speed, ensuring smooth playback without constant interruptions. Offline download capabilities are particularly valuable for commuters or travelers who want to watch episodes without relying on internet connectivity.

Content Library and Update Frequency

The size and diversity of a platform’s K-drama library directly impact your viewing options. Leading apps regularly update their catalogs with new releases, often premiering episodes shortly after their Korean broadcast. Some platforms even offer simulcast features, allowing international viewers to watch episodes within hours of their original airing.

Beyond current releases, comprehensive libraries include classic K-dramas, allowing new fans to discover beloved series from previous years. Genre diversity ensures you can explore everything from romantic comedies and melodramas to action thrillers and historical period pieces.

🎭 Different K-Drama Genres and Where to Find Them

Korean television produces diverse drama genres, each with distinct characteristics and devoted fanbases. Understanding genre conventions helps you navigate app libraries more effectively and discover content matching your mood and preferences.

Romantic Comedies

Rom-coms represent K-drama’s most popular genre, featuring charming love stories with humorous situations and heartwarming character development. These series typically offer lighter viewing experiences perfect for unwinding after stressful days. Most streaming apps feature extensive rom-com collections, often categorizing them by themes like office romance, celebrity relationships, or fantasy elements.

Historical Dramas (Sageuks)

Period dramas set in historical Korea showcase elaborate costumes, palace intrigue, and epic narratives spanning decades. These productions require significant budgets and extensive research, resulting in visually stunning series that educate while entertaining. Historical drama enthusiasts should prioritize apps with strong sageuk libraries and high-definition streaming capabilities to appreciate the detailed production design.

Thrillers and Crime Dramas

Korean television excels at suspenseful storytelling, producing psychological thrillers and crime dramas with complex plots and unexpected twists. These series often feature darker themes and mature content, appealing to viewers seeking intense, edge-of-your-seat narratives. Look for apps with robust content rating systems that help you identify appropriate viewing material.
